| Description: | This domain is found in various eukaryotic species, particularly in apicomplexans such as Plasmodium falciparum, where it is found in proteins that are important in various parasite-host cell interactions. It is thought to be an RNA-binding domain (PUBMED:15501674). |
| InterPro ACC: | IPR013584 |
| InterPro abstract: | The ~60-residue RAP (an acronym for RNA-binding domain abundant in Apicomplexans) domain is found in various proteins in eukaryotes. It is particularly abundant in apicomplexans and might mediate a range of cellular functions through its potential interactions with RNA [ PUBMED:15501674 ]. The RAP domain consists … expand |
